Even starting on 7/10 you can't have full contact until 8/1. So how can teams get away with having a jamboree event tonight on 7/29?? Unless they are playing touch or flag, it would seem this would violate KHSAA regulations regarding acclimation.

 

5 days in helmets

3 days shells

3 days full go.

 

Have to have 11 practices in before any scrimmage/game. (which the above takes care of anyways)

 

Nothing that says no contact before August 1st.

Got it. Fair enough. Not sure why the MS rules are more lenient than high school, but that's a whole other debate.

 

Partially due to the calendar. KHSAA wants MS football over by week 11 or week 12. However in some areas thats an issue because they dont finish till week 14 or 15 (one of those being a very large district that has strong ties to the KHSAA). Also, if you allow for the 10 game weeks, 5 post season weeks (same as what HS has) and you want to be done by week 11 or 12, you have to move other timelines up.
